My truck has less thaan 700 miles, it's been 18 to 22 deg out, at a steady 55 or 70 mph the coolant temp swing 2-3 marks on the gauge. It swing from about 192 to 204 and will go to 210 it I get on it.
Is this normal, This my first duramax and my point of comparison is my Tahoe which has a very steady temp gauge.

Tomc: I believe this is fairly standard. I also have the attitude monitor which displays engine temp. It will fluctuate from 181 degress to about 195 depending on driving conditions. I also see the big swing on the dash temperature gauge.

These vehicles cool off very fast in cold weather when they are not "working". From what I know the condition you describe is 100% normal.
